Dining, Entertainment & Shopping
There are plenty of exciting places to dine and shop in Keystone for the whole family. First, stop by Kickapoo Tavern apres-ski. A local favorite since 1995, the tavern is located in River Run Village and is known for serving up delicious burgers and Mexican food. Additionally, you can’t go wrong with Montezuma Roadhouse, an American style restaurant featuring a great happy hour with tasty appetizers. Finally, there’s Snake River Steakhouse, a restaurant and bar known for its live music and its tasty seafood and steaks with a kids’ menu that younger family members love.
The majority of Keystone’s shops are in River Run. However, there are a handful of shops in Lakeside Village and the Mountain House base area as well. In addition, Bath and Body Works, Calvin Klein, Coach, Eddie Bauer, Harry & David, and many other well-known brands can be found at the Silverthorne Outlet Mall, which is only ten minutes away.

For example, the renowned Keystone Ski Resort is the perfect place to enjoy winter sports. Featuring three stunning mountains and five bowls, this is a dream destination for skiers. Throughout the winter, visitors can ski at night, skate on the five-acre lake, or relax on a festive sleigh ride. As the weather warms up, explore hundreds of miles of mountain bike trails or ride the lift to access scenic hiking.
In the spring, the Keystone Ski Resort’s famed golf courses open up. Hence, avid golfers can enjoy two distinct styles of play on either the River Course and Keystone Ranch. Unquestionably, you’ll have the time of your life golfing against a gorgeous mountain backdrop!
During the summer, there are plenty of exciting events in Keystone. For example, the Mountain Town Music Series in River Run Village is perfect for the whole family, featuring performances outdoors. In addition, there are a number of other festivals held in Keystone throughout the summer, including the Bacon and Bourbon Festival, the Wine and Jazz Festival, the River Run Village Art Festival, and the Bluegrass & Beer Festival.
